Output 11def609d8665eb9c32f11f08fcde35e0498f0168184e2feeda955f0502d0a23:2

value
355000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74882a40b1c03a1512f3882a4d6c3f4f60ded5b4 OP_EQUAL
address
3CKBRi7Kta7eGfWovPnNZVhgThjTm5NAU2
transaction
11def609d8665eb9c32f11f08fcde35e0498f0168184e2feeda955f0502d0a23
spent
true